Texas Code § 159.318

ASSISTANCE WITH DISCOVERY

Sec. 159.318. ASSISTANCE WITH DISCOVERY. A tribunal of this state may:
(1) request a tribunal outside this state to assist in obtaining discovery; and
(2) on request, compel a person over whom the tribunal has jurisdiction to respond to a discovery order issued by a tribunal outside this state.
